  • They can not fire you for being pregnant, however, they don't necessarily have to keep your position during maternity leave. I would start reading up on FMLA (if your company qualifies) and speak with your supervisor/HR person in the next few weeks. Good luck.

However, you will be happy to know that you do have rights in this matter. Your work can't lay you off because you're pregnant and need to go on leave next January, thats considered discrimination and against the law. If I were you, I would read the thread titled "Not Eligible for FMLA?" from yesterday. There is a lot of good information in there about pregnancy laws and your rights.

    Once you've read that, and read up in FMLA, I would sit your boss and manager down and tell them. Let them know what your plan is, tell them that you had no idea you were pregnant when they hired you, and just be open and honest with them. If after that, they start pulling anything hoakie, or start picking on you like my boss is doing, document it all. The date, time, what they said, who was there to witness it, everything. And if they try anything while you're out on leave, or when you return, they try and screw you over, you have a smoking gun for a lawsuit with evidence to back it up.
